Abstract
A method for correcting a signal delivered by a slave measuring instrument with respect to a reference signal delivered by a master measuring instrument of the same type involved in the analyzing of the same product includes the provision of standardization signals delivered by both the slave instrument and the master instrument as they analyze calibration products, each calibration product having a particular known calibration characteristic. These standardization signals are subjected to series decomposition so that they are simplified prior to their being formed into a correction coefficient matrix useful in correcting a signal derived from a slave measuring instrument performing an actual analysis of the characteristic of a test product like the calibration products. When a test product undergoes analysis, it is analyzed by the slave measuring instrument to determine a signal which is then subject to a further series decomposition and correction with the aid of the stored correction matrix.
